Jed Myers is a Philadelphian living in Seattle. He’s a psychiatrist with a therapy practice and teaches at the University of Washington. Two of his poetry collections, The Nameless (Finishing Line Press) and Watching the Perseids (winner of the 2013 Sacramento Poetry Center Book Award), are being released in 2014.
